Welcome to the Eventline schema registry! Quick orientation before you start reviewing PRs: every event type in the Parloq platform gets a versioned schema here, and breaking changes need a migration note plus sign-off from the registry stewards. Most reviews are just checking compatibility mode (stick with BACKWARD unless someone has a really good reason). If the registry admin console locks you out during a review, you can restore access with the stewardship recovery flow. The passphrase for that flow is:

vault phrase of bagaf-kajeg = jorath-feniel-briir-siliel-ralix

**Harrowfield Gateway — ingest path.** Each tractor unit authenticates with a per-device certificate minted at provisioning; the gateway rejects any telemetry frame lacking a valid chain, and rate-limits per device to contain a compromised unit. Clock skew beyond the allowed window invalidates frames to prevent replay. All limits are enforced before deserialization. The enforcement constants under review are listed below.

tuning table, bagep-tahof:
RATE_LIMITS = {
    "ralael": 10,
    "druath": 5,
}

Action item from the Bramblewick audit: 14 components fail WCAG AA contrast, mostly muted-gray text on the settings panels. Contractor to update tokens in the shared palette, not per-component overrides. Re-run the automated sweep after each batch and attach results to the ticket. The failing component list and token map live here.

runbook for badug-kadup: https://confluence.zemvarlabs.internal/projects/browse/display/projects/bd1b